Identifying Lawn Sprinkler Issues
Identifying sprinkler concerns is an essential very first step in reliable lawn sprinkler repair service. Appropriate identification of issues guarantees that the ideal services are applied, minimizing downtime and preventing more damages. Typical sprinkler issues consist of low tide pressure, uneven water circulation, non-rotating sprinkler heads, and visible wear or damages to parts.
Carrying out a methodical inspection is crucial. Begin by visually examining the lawn sprinkler heads for any type of signs of physical damages or blockage. Dust and particles can obstruct water circulation, resulting in ineffective procedure. Next, observe the lawn sprinkler system during its operation. Note any kind of disparities in water stress or uneven spray patterns, which can suggest underlying concerns such as blocked nozzles or damaged pipes.
Additionally, examine the control valves and timer settings to guarantee they are functioning properly. Breakdowns in these elements can lead to over-watering or under-watering specific locations. Examine the location bordering the sprinkler system for indications of water merging or abnormally dry patches, which may recommend leakages or poor coverage.
Taking Care Of Leakages
Addressing leakages in an automatic sprinkler is important to keeping its performance and protecting against water waste. Leakages can take place as a result of different reasons, such as worn-out seals, broken pipelines, or damaged links. Determining the source of the leak is the first action. Check the whole system, concentrating on lawn sprinkler heads, shutoffs, and pipelines. Seek merging water or abnormally wet areas in the yard as signs.
As soon as the leak resource is identified, transform off the water supply to the sprinkler system. For leakages at the sprinkler head, unscrew the head and examine the seal.
For leaks at valve links, tighten up the fittings or change damaged parts as required. Constantly make sure that all repair services are watertight prior to transforming the supply of water back on. Regular upkeep and timely fixings can substantially prolong the life-span of your automatic sprinkler and contribute to water preservation efforts.
Readjusting Spray Patterns
To adjust the spray pattern, very first determine the type of lawn sprinkler head in operation, as various designs have differed modification systems. For repaired spray heads, locate the change screw on top. Using a tiny flat-head screwdriver, transform the screw clockwise to decrease the spray distance or counterclockwise to boost it. For rotor-type sprinklers, adjustments typically entail an essential or a specialized tool to modify the arc and span. Consult the manufacturer's guidelines for accurate adjustments.
Next, observe the lawn sprinkler in procedure. Make sure that the spray reaches the wanted protection area without overlapping exceedingly onto walkways, driveways, or buildings. Winterizing Your Automatic Sprinkler
Proper winterization of your lawn sprinkler is essential to avoid expensive damage and ensure its preparedness for the following expanding period. When temperatures flexible sprinkler riser drop, any water left in the pipes can freeze, expand, and possibly create splits or ruptured pipelines. To stay clear of such problems, begin by shutting down the supply of water to the irrigation system. Next, drain pipes the system to get rid of recurring water from pipelines, shutoffs, and lawn sprinkler heads. This can be done making use of the hand-operated drainpipe valve technique, the automatic drain valve approach, or by employing an air compressor to blow out the system.
Utilizing an air compressor is frequently considered the most effective approach. Link the compressor to the watering system, setting the stress to no more than 50 PSI for PVC pipelines or 80 PSI for versatile polyethylene pipes. Sequentially turn on each zone to make certain that all water is gotten rid of.
